Linked list implementation of stack program
Nettet17. apr. 2024 · Linked List Implementation for Stack Linked List Linked List can be defined as collection of objects called nodes that are randomly stored in the memory. A node contains two fields i.e. data stored at that particular address and the pointer which contains the address of the next node in the memory. Nettet12. sep. 2016 · Another important program in data structure is here. previously we have posted stack operations using array. Today we are going to implement stack operations using Linked list. In this program there are total 8 Operations i.e Push, Pop, Display, Display Top, Empty, Destroy, Stack Count, and Exit. We have added comments …
Linked list implementation of stack program
Did you know?
NettetIntroduction. A Stack is one of the most fundamental and extremely used Data structures. Linked Lists also fall in the same category as stacks having a wide range of usages. There are various ways of implementing a stack, it may be using a Queue, an Array, or any other data structure. In this article, we are going to take a look at how to … NettetLinked List Utility Lists are one of the most popular and efficient data structures, with implementation in every programming language like C, C++, Python, Java, and C#. …
NettetIn computer science, an abstract data type (ADT) is a mathematical model for data types.An abstract data type is defined by its behavior from the point of view of a user, of the data, specifically in terms of possible values, possible operations on data of this type, and the behavior of these operations.This mathematical model contrasts with data … NettetIn this program, we will see how to implement stack using Linked List in java. The Stack is an abstract data type that demonstrates Last in first out ( LIFO) behavior. We will implement the same behavior using Linked List. There are two most important operations of Stack: Push : We will push element to beginning of linked list to demonstrate ...
NettetWrite a C program to convert Infix expression to Prefix expression using linked list implementation of stacks. This problem has been solved! You'll get a detailed solution from a subject matter expert that helps you learn core concepts.
Nettet26. mar. 2024 · Explain the stack by using linked list in C language - Stack over flow and stack under flow can be avoided by allocating memory dynamically.Operations carried …
Nettet17. mar. 2024 · Stack and doubly linked lists are two important data structures with their own benefits. Stack is a data structure that follows the LIFO technique and can be … data free knowledge transferNettetThe doubly linked list node has three fields: data, the next node’s address, and the previous node’s address. The node of a Doubly linked list: To implement a stack … dataframe 検索 pythonNettet23. apr. 2024 · In this tutorial we will implement a stack data structure using singly linked list data structure. We will make a singly linked list work like a stack which means it will work in a LAST IN FIRST OUT (LIFO) mode. Lastly we will write a C++Program to implement this Stack using Singly Linked List. data free hiking apps for androidNettetTo implement a stack using a linked list, we need to set the following things before implementing actual operations. Step 1 - Include all the header files which are used in the program. And declare all the user defined functions. Step 2 - Define a ' Node ' structure with two members data and next. Step 3 - Define a Node pointer ' top ' and set ... bit of gipNettetIn linked list implementation of stack, the nodes are maintained non-contiguously in the memory. Each node contains a pointer to its immediate successor node in the stack. … data free flow with trust とはNettet23. jun. 2015 · stack in implement two way. first in using array and second is using linked list. some disadvatages in using array then most of programmer use linked list in stack implement. first is stack using linked list first not declare stack size and not limited data store in stack. second is linked list in pointer essay to declare and using it. data-free knowledge distillationNettet11. jan. 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. bit of glitter